Sergey Cherepanov is a Russian pipe maker who began his career at a fairly mature age. His passion for the pipe brought him to Mikhail Revyagin and Viktor Yashtylov, who shared their experience and taught him a lot. Now Sergey is working in his own workshop in the suburbs as a professional pipe maker, producing about 100 pipes a year. Cherepanov gives leans toward freehand shapes. He uses Mimmo briar, and Mino, and less often, Jaume Houm, as well as German and Japanese ebonite. Even during work, he doesn't part with the pipe, preferring comfortable nosogreyk stuffed with a classic clean Virginia.
